Santa Maria Fire St. 5 fully staffed today

Today is the first day new Station 5 in Santa Maria will be fully staffed.

Crews will include some of the new fire fighters who finished training three days ago.

Chief Dan Orr says Station Five on E. Donovan will increase response time by 20%.

The new station was built with federal money the city received back in 2009.

The Santa Maria Fire Department will also receive funds from "Measure U."

The sales tax increase went into effect in October.
